Compare Wealthfront vs OANDA Commission And Fees
Wealthfront and OANDA are online brokerage platforms, and most online brokerages charge lower prices than traditional brokerages tend to charge. The cause of this is that the companies of online trading platforms are scaled better. In other words, an internet broker isn't necessarily affected by the amount of customers they have.
However, this doesn't mean that online brokers don't charge any fees. They charge fees of varying rates for various services to make money. There are primarily three different types of penalties for this purpose.
The first sort of charges to keep an eye out for are trading charges. Whenever you make an actual trade, like buying a stock or an ETF, you are billed trading charges. In these instances, you're spending a spread, funding speed, or even a commission. The sorts of trading fees and the prices vary from broker to broker.
Commissions can be fixed or dependent on the traded volume. On the other hand, a spread refers to the difference between the buying and selling price. Funding or overnight prices are those that are billed when you maintain a leveraged position for more than daily.
Apart from trading fees, online brokers also bill non-trading fees. These are determined by the activities you undertake in your account. They're charged for surgeries like depositing money, not investing for long periods, or withdrawals.
